2010 Range Rover Pricing Announced

Posted: Jul 16, 2009

2010 Range Rover

Land Rover has priced that 2010 Ranger Rover lineup starting with the $79,275 HSE and $95,125 for the Supercharged model (prices include an $850 shipping charge).

Options on both Range Rover models include a rear-seat entertainment for $2,500, 20-inch wheels for $1,500, a wood-and-leather steering wheel for $1,000 and a selection of custom wood trims at $2,300. The 2010 Range Rover HSE can be ordered with a $4,950 luxury interior package and the Supercharged can be ordered with a $14,500 Autobiography package.

The naturally-aspirated 375-hp LR-V8 now allows the 2010 Range Rover Sport to go from 0 to 60 mph in 7.2 seconds while the 510-hp supercharged Range Rover Sport goes from 0 to 60 in 5.9 seconds.
